AGnVET is an Australian owned independent agribusiness, providing rural supplies and services. Established in Forbes NSW in 1915, they have over 70 branches located throughout the Eastern States and their iconic brands include AGnVET, IK Caldwell AGnVET, Wheelhouse AGnVET, AGnVET Rural and specialist water and irrigation business Darling Irrigation.
In 2018 the business established our unique AGnVET Betta Livestock Services brand to focus on developing our Animal Health Category and better service our livestock customers. The success and progression of the services provided under Betta Livestock has meant that we need to further expand our Animal Production team to accommodate our growing customer demands.
